## Handover: nightly reindex (Fenwick Search)

Taking over from Dalia. Reindex runs nightly, full rebuild, swaps alias on success. If it dies mid-run, old index stays live — safe to rerun. Don't shrink the worker pool; throughput tanks. Watch disk on the staging node during merges. Alerting goes to the search channel. Current job configuration is as follows.

deployment values, bagag-bawig:
DRUVAN_PIN=0740
DRUVAN_TENANT=wendor
DRUVAN_METRICS_HOST=metrics.druvan.tolvaqnet.example
DRUVAN_SEAL=seal_75cd0b2d
DRUVAN_STANDBY_TEAM=tamael

## Break-glass access — Fanout N+1 fix rollout

For this week's sync: the Orvane GraphQL gateway patch batching resolver calls (the N+1 fix) is feature-flagged. If the flag service is unreachable during an incident, break-glass access to the flag override console is permitted, but only with on-call approval logged in the incident channel. The override console sits behind the sealed ops vault; unsealing it requires the recovery passphrase, which is:

unlock words, kajef-kadug: sorys-pelax-lamael-tamvan-briiel-novdor-fenwyn-tamdor-oliion-keleth-julok-belion-ralok

**Finance Review — Concentration Risk**

Greylock Fittings now represents 37% of branch network revenue. One account at that weight is above our risk threshold. Branch managers: no new exclusivity terms, no extended payment concessions to Greylock without central approval. Diversification targets arrive with next month's plan. Quarterly exposure reporting becomes mandatory from October. The confidential direction from leadership is set out below.

confidential, kagep-kahof: Druokax Systems plans to lower the Ulaath list price by 53 percent in March.